Output db76abb807ecb556af20a3e94f4c4210578372b6e70cb95e6878a09cf1932d8f:2

value
65991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b6014fcb037166e5b4937cec9337f6fe0d0eff1 OP_EQUAL
address
38ZZhpkVs8ErqUa5cMjhKBpMvHz9CcQhg6
transaction
db76abb807ecb556af20a3e94f4c4210578372b6e70cb95e6878a09cf1932d8f
confirmations
218941
spent
true